Monroe Supports McKenna, Romano

I am writing this letter to express my support for Donna McKenna and Andrew Romano for the open seats on the Fairhaven Select Board. 

I have had the pleasure of working with Donna McKenna for the past 12 years as a member of the Fairhaven School Committee. 

In that time, I found her to be an extraordinary and genuine person with a passion for her hometown. She is an ardent volunteer in our commu­nity and has spent countless hours supporting various activities for our schools. 

Her unwavering commitment to important issues has marked Donna McKenna’s tenure on the committee. She has been a long-time member of the civil rights and anti-bullying task forces, championing the cause against bullying. Her support for special education, as Fairhaven’s representative to the Southeastern Massachusetts Educational Col­labora­tive (SMEC), has been stead­fast. Donna’s dedication to these causes is a testament to her commit­ment to our community. 

With her extensive municipal expe­ri­ence from the school committee and financial insight gained from the mortgage industry, Donna McKenna is the candidate Fairhaven needs. Her dedication to our town is unwavering, and her ability to navigate municipal government and balance budgets is unparalleled. She is a straight shooter, ready to take on the task of serving on the Select Board. 

My support also extends to Andrew Romano. I’ve had the privilege of knowing him since his high school days when he managed the audio for school committee meetings. Since then, I’ve witnessed his remarkable growth and develop­ment into a world-class real estate agent, small business owner, and respected community member. This journey has equipped him with a unique set of skills and perspectives that make him a strong candidate for the Select Board. 

Andrew, a familiar face in our community, is a candidate who will bring a much-needed fresh per­spective to the Select Board. His track record of community service, from his role as the director of the Fairhaven Government Access Channel to his current positions on the Zoning Board of Appeals and as the President of the North Fairhaven Improvement Association (NFIA), is a testament to his commitment. 

Andrew’s trustworthiness, forth­right­ness, and capability to handle challenging issues make him the ideal candidate for the Select Board. 

Please join me in voting for Donna McKenna and Andrew Romano for the Fairhaven Select Board on Monday, April 1, 2024. 

Brian Monroe, Fairhaven School Committee Member
